There's no way that you have enough cam to support 6500 rpm on a 572.

Like Bobby said, you'll sling all the oil away from the parts on a Bravo above 6000.

You can use lots more duration and if you keep your lift under .650, your springs may actually live. Much above that, and you'll have to run so much spring pressure, that your lifters will have a short and troubled life.
